Thomas Jefferson Classical Academy has gone 10-0 against Highland Tech recently and they'll look to pad the win column further on Tuesday. The Thomas Jefferson Classical Academy Gryphons just played yesterday, but they'll still head out to face the Highland Tech Rams at 5:00 p.m. Thomas Jefferson Classical Academy is coming into the match hot, having won their last six games.
Thomas Jefferson Classical Academy is headed into the game after thoroughly thrashing Lake Lure Classical Academy: they outscored them in every quarter. Given that consistent dominance, it should come as no surprise that Thomas Jefferson Classical Academy blew Lake Lure Classical Academy out of the water with a 66-11 final score. The Gryphons have made a habit of sweeping their opponents off the court, having now won 11 contests by 21 points or more this season.
Meanwhile, Highland Tech lost to Shelby at home by a 45-30 margin on Friday. While losing is never fun, the Rams can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' North Carolina basketball rankings (they are ranked 481st, while the Golden Lions are ranked 217th).
Thomas Jefferson Classical Academy's victory was their fourth straight on the road, which pushed their record up to 14-6. Those victories came thanks to their defensive effort, having only surrendered 16.5 points per game. As for Highland Tech, they have been struggling recently as they've lost five of their last six matchups, which put a noticeable dent in their 7-12 record this season.
Everything came up roses for Thomas Jefferson Classical Academy against Highland Tech in their previous meeting back in January, as the team secured a 62-11 win. The rematch might be a little tougher for Thomas Jefferson Classical Academy since the squad won't have the home-court advantage this time around. We'll see if the change in venue makes a difference.
